Transaction d23bbaad78b17ed43e401d1872f37101062ccb700e34951eb5f803fabc530345
1 Input
1 Output
-
d23bbaad78b17ed43e401d1872f37101062ccb700e34951eb5f803fabc530345:0
- value
- 138308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f69e56194828a7c635f038cd8dedc5a6dfd0993f OP_EQUAL
- address
- 3QB1q8mCbCnKqJovsJVwSJ2cjoTpuA5Xvx